Bonjour,
j'ai une requête SQL (fonctionnel) qui tappe dans plusieurs bases afin de récupérer des informations. Un problème intervient lors de l'affichage de ces champs dans un tableau HTML, car ils ont le même nom.
Voici ma requête SQL :
Et voici un début de code pour l'affichage des résultats :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 $query = "SELECT c.id, c.nom, tc.nom, ti.nom, c.description FROM consommables c, typeImprimante ti, typeConsommable tc WHERE c.refTypeConso = tc.id AND c.refTypeImp = ti.id;";
Le problème est que je ne sais pas différencier (en PHP) le champ nom de ma table consommable, de celui de ma table typeConsommables ...
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 while ($row = mysql_fetch_object($result)) { echo "<tr><td>".$row->id."</td><td>".$row->nom."</td><td>".$row->nom."</td><td>".$row->nom."</td><td>".$row->description."</td><td></td></tr>"; }
Si vous avez une idée ou une piste, je suis preneur.
Merci d'avance.
Partager